Jennifer Hudson’s first single of her upcoming sophomore album, I Remember Me, is the drum-heavy, R. Kelly-produced and -written tune “Where You At.” The oft-delayed album will hit stores (hopefully) March 22.
Alicia Keys, Swizz Beatz, Ne-Yo, and Stargate have contributed to the project, which Hudson calls “a renewal.”
“I’m excited about this album because it’s almost like a renewal for me, reflected through the chapters of my life. I’ve called it I Remember Me because of the journey I’ve been on. I’ve learned that life constantly surprises you, no matter your plans. My fans have been so loyal, I feel like they have been on this journey with me and I can’t wait for them to hear the new album.”
